The 'Developmental Computational Psychiatry' lab and the W3 professorship 'Computational Psychiatry' led by Tobias Hauser at the University of Tübingen (Germany) is currently hiring new postdocs. The focus of the lab is to better understand the computational and neural mechanisms underlying decision making and learning, and how these processes go awry in patients with mental illnesses. The successful candidates will have the chance to work in a highly dynamic and inspiring environment and to collaborate closely with Prof Peter Dayan and the Max-Planck Institute for Biological Cybernetics. Concretely, we are looking for the following candidates: Postdoc with experimental & neuroimaging background, Postdoc with computational modelling background.
